Drupal Developer Resume Example & Writing Guide

A strong resume is key to landing Drupal Developer jobs. This guide provides a Drupal Developer resume sample and easy tips to help you build a resume that highlights your skills and experience. Learn what to include and how to structure each section to impress hiring managers. Use this advice to quickly improve your resume and get more interviews.

Creating a resume that properly highlights your Drupal development skills and experience is key to landing the job you want. But what exactly should you include in your resume to stand out from other candidates?

This guide breaks down the essential components of a powerful Drupal developer resume. Learn how to effectively showcase your technical abilities, past projects, and credentials. Follow these tips to structure your resume in a clear, readable format that grabs the attention of hiring managers.

We've also included a complete Drupal developer resume example that you can use for inspiration. See how to put these strategies into practice and craft a resume that gives you the best shot at scoring an interview.

By the end of this article, you'll know exactly what it takes to build a compelling Drupal developer resume. Let's dive into the details of how to market yourself successfully and accelerate your job search. With the right approach, your resume will open doors to exciting opportunities in the Drupal development field.

Common Responsibilities Listed on Drupal Developer Resumes

  • Building and customizing Drupal websites and applications
  • Designing and implementing Drupal themes and templates
  • Developing custom Drupal modules and features
  • Integrating third-party systems and APIs with Drupal
  • Ensuring website performance, security, and scalability
  • Performing site maintenance, updates, and upgrades
  • Troubleshooting and debugging Drupal issues
  • Optimizing Drupal websites for search engines (SEO)
  • Collaborating with cross-functional teams (designers, project managers, etc.)

How to write a Resume Summary

The summary or objective section of your resume carries immense importance when it comes to catching an employer's attention. More often than not, this is the first part an employer reads when examining your resume. Essentially, it sets the tone for the rest of your application. As succinct as it may be, it tells your prospective employer who you are, what you can do, and what you wish to achieve professionally.

Primarily, your summary or objective, as a Drupal developer, must convey one thing clearly: your proficiency and experience in Drupal technology. Yet, it needs to do so without sliding into the banality of repeating oft-said phrases or leaning on jargon. Here's a simple, step-by-step guide to creating a captivating summary or objective, without incorporating the banned keywords.

Start by identifying yourself as a professional Drupal Developer. This direct, this transparency, does wonders by immediately aligning you with the available Drupal Developer position.

Include your relevant experience. How many years have you worked as a Drupal Developer? Remember, specify and quantify; stating that you have 'multiple years of experience' is less potent than saying '5 years of experience.' Emphasize this practical, hands-on familiarity with Drupal; such a demonstration can surely capture an employer's interest.

Next, identify your most impressive accomplishments or skills pertaining to Drupal Development. It could be a considerable, impressive project you delivered, or specific technical skills you have honed. Avoid being vague and ensure that these skills or accomplishments align with the job you're applying for.

Do not forget to mention your intentions and what you hope to accomplish in this role. Try to align your goals with the company's goals. Demonstrating an understanding of the company's objectives and showing how they complement your personal aspirations can present you as an optimal fit for the team.

Avoid using too technical terminology; making your language more accessible can work wonders. Despite your prospective employer being familiar with Drupal, translation of your skills into broader concepts can be beneficial. Bear in mind, your future team or manager might not be as 'tech-savvy' as you are. Reflecting your tech know-how into broader business or project outcomes can make your summary relatable, engaging, and enlightening.

Sidestep generic information that does not contribute much to your unique profile. "Hardworking professional with X years' of experience..." can sound cliché and redundant. Tailor the summary to reflect you, not an archetypal Drupal Developer.

At all times, remember this: A well-written SUMMARY commands ATTENTION; a well-written OBJECTIVE sustains this attention. A blend of both not only jolts and holds an employer's notice, it sways it favorably in your direction.

Ultimately, your summary or objective remains a hospitable looking-glass into your capabilities, accomplishments, and aspirations as a Drupal Developer. Make it interesting, make it engaging, and most importantly, make it informative.

Strong Summaries

  • Innovative Drupal Developer with 5 years of experience in designing and implementing Drupal-based solutions. Proficient in creating custom themes and modules, optimizing website performance, and integrating third-party applications. Committed to responsive design and high-quality user experiences.
  • Dynamic Drupal Developer with a demonstrated history of working in the software industry. Skilled in Drupal, PHP, and web services. Strong engineering professional with a passion for crafting innovative solutions that streamline operations and drive growth.
  • Seasoned Drupal Developer with 7+ years of experience, specializing in backend development. Known for creating and customizing Drupal themes and modules, with a deep understanding of Drupal core. Proven ability in optimizing web functionalities that improve data retrieval and workflow efficiencies.
  • Accomplished Drupal Developer with a decade of experience in developing, scaling, and optimizing Drupal websites for various industries. Expert in PHP, MySQL, and JavaScript. Delivers clean, maintainable code while keeping user experience and client satisfaction of paramount importance.

Why these are strong?

These examples are good because they outline the developer’s experience and skills pertaining specifically to Drupal, clearly demonstrating their knowledge and competency. They also give a sense of the candidate’s approach to their work, such as innovative solutions, crafting functional and optimized web functionalities, or maintaining user satisfaction. This gives potential employers a clear, concise summary of the candidate’s capabilities and professionalism. Additionally, specific technical terms included can highlight the candidate's in-depth knowledge of the field.

Weak Summaries

  • I am a Drupal Developer looking for any job that pays well.
  • Seeking a role as a Drupal Developer. I know some programming and have created some websites.
  • I have a decent familiarity with Drupal-based web development and I think I am pretty good at it.
  • Looking for a Drupal development job that allows me to work minimum hours but pays high.
  • Becoming a Drupal Developer was a random choice and I have gained some random experience in it.
  • Hoping to land a Drupal development job that can pay for my bills.

Why these are weak?

The above examples are bad practices for several reasons. First off, they show a lack of commitment to the role and the profession, hinting that the job seeker is only motivated by monetary incentives. Second, they display a level of unprofessionalism by using casual and vague language. They don't quantify achievements or provide clear information about the candidate's skills or experience. For example, 'knowing some programming' or 'decent familiarity' is very vague and unimpressive. Lastly, they fail to illustrate the candidate's understanding of Drupal or its applications. Instead of focusing just on immediate benefits, the professional summary should focus on the skills, experiences, and value the candidate can bring to the company.

Showcase your Work Experience

When assembling a resume, the focus often gravitates towards the Work Experience section. This crucial component becomes the narrative of your professional journey, displaying both your acumen and value in a real-world context. Yet despite its importance, developing an impactful Work Experience section isn’t as daunting as it may seem. This task becomes much easier when approached with a certain sense of clarity and a firm understanding of what you need to showcase.

As a Drupal Developer, you’ve likely accumulated a portfolio full of projects that reflect your skillset and expertise. But, how do you condense all this valuable experience into a digestible and exciting feature in your resume? It's simpler than you think.

Keep It Relevant

First and foremost, you need to ensure the jobs and projects you list are pertinent to the position you're targeting. Relevance can't overemphasized because it gives an indicator of your preparedness for the prospective role. Mingling non-relevant experience may stir confusion, diluting the focus from your specialized Drupal Development expertise. Therefore, sift through your past endeavors, deciding on those significant moments in your career that highlight your development skills, particularly those concerning Drupal.

Success Indicators

Identify key roles where your efforts brought success to the project or the company as a whole. How did your role as a Drupal Developer change the face of things? These indicators of success are essential to note in your work experience section, so potential employers can identify not just what you have done, but what you can do for them.

Expert Tip

Quantify your achievements and impact using concrete numbers, metrics, and percentages to demonstrate the value you brought to your previous roles.

Use Performance Metrics

When you talk about your roles and successes, it's beneficial to have numbers to back up your talk. If you have managed to improve a website's loading time, state by how much. If your development work helped improve traffic or conversion, what were those percentages? Hard numbers bring a concrete layer of trustworthiness to your claims.

Be Clear About Your Role

In many development projects, it's not a solo show. You likely have worked as part of a team. While listing such projects, be clear about your role in the team. What were your responsibilities and how did those impact the overall result? This clarity gives a sense of your teamwork skills and what can you bring to a collective working environment.

This approach to the Work Experience section will not only portray your expertise and authoritativeness but also present a trustworthy narrative of your professional journey. Even without examples, the impact of well-presented work experience is quite evident. Now, armed with these insights, you have the tools to delve into your past endeavors and bring forth a story that truly exemplifies your worth as a valued Drupal Developer.

Constructing your Work Experience section is not about echoing what every other applicant writes. It's about responding directly to the needs andpain points of your prospective employer. Remember, your resume is ultimately about the value you can offer. Tailor your Work Experience section in an engaging, concise, and insightful manner to make that value crystal clear.

Strong Experiences

  • Developed multiple Drupal based websites enabling clients to attract more online visitors, leading to a 30% increase in online sales
  • Collaborated with cross-functional teams to deliver seamless user interface for Drupal websites, improving overall user experience
  • Coded and implemented custom modules based on the client's needs and project requirements
  • Utilized PHP in conjunction with Drupal to create a versatile and effective CMS for multiple client websites
  • Proficient in using Drush command line shell and scripting interface for Drupal, which improved website development efficiency
  • Maintained and troubleshoot several Drupal websites, resulting in minimizing site downtimes
  • Trained staff and end-users on Drupal functionalities, helping them to manage the content on the website more efficiently

Why these are strong?

The examples provided are compelling as they are outcome-oriented, demonstrating not only the tasks performed but also the outcomes and impacts of these tasks. They highlight the use of skills and knowledge in Drupal and PHP, effective collaboration in teams, problem-solving, and contribution to user experience and business progress. It is good practice because they relate directly to the role of a Drupal Developer and demonstrate significant achievements that employers would find valuable.

Weak Experiences

  • Operating Drupal - Experienced
  • Created Drupal themes and templates – 1.5 years
  • Collaborated with cross-functional team - Regularly
  • Responsible for back-end development - Yes
  • Worked with Drupal 7 and 8 - Often
  • Building various Drupal websites - Numerous times
  • Attending client meetings - Occasionally
  • Trained junior developers - Several times

Why these are weak?

The above examples are considered as bad for several reasons. First, they're vague as they do not provide quantifiable results or details about specific projects or accomplishments. For instance, 'Operating Drupal - Experienced' or 'Worked with Drupal 7 and 8 - Often' does not provide details on what was precisely accomplished while operating Drupal. Second, they include terminology or expressions that do not contribute to understanding the value or impact, such as 'Regularly', 'Yes', 'Often', 'Numerous times', and 'Occasionally'. Third, they fail to demonstrate the scope of the responsibility or the effect of the work, such as 'Responsible for back-end development - Yes'. Such practices would not be appealing to recruiters as they do not convincingly illustrate the candidate's experience, skills, and achievements.

Skills, Keywords & ATS Tips

A resume isn't merely a list of your work experiences; it is a strategic representation of your capabilities. For a Drupal Developer, specific skills matter, generally segmented into "hard" and "soft" skills. These can differentiate you from the competition when applying for jobs and could be the gateway to getting your dream job.

Hard Skills for a Drupal Developer

Hard skills are technical abilities specific to a job or task. As a Drupal Developer, hard skills encompass expertise in PHP, HTML/CSS, MySQL, and of course, Drupal. Also, understanding of JavaScript, jQuery, and familiarity with SEO and UX principles, can also distinguish you. These are concrete skills that you learn and can be measured. They display your technical proficiency and ability to perform specific tasks.

Soft Skills for a Drupal Developer

Soft skills, on the other hand, include more general skills that are transferable across jobs and industries. As a developer, good communication, teamwork, problem-solving abilities, attention to detail, and adaptability are significant examples of these skills. Despite being less tangible than hard skills, soft skills play a vital role in your success as a Drupal Developer. They help you to interact effectively with clients and teams, contribute positively to the work environment, and manage challenges and changes in your job.

ATS, Keywords, and Skills

When you apply for a job online, your resume usually first passes through an Applicant Tracking System (ATS). This software screens resumes to determine which ones are most relevant to the job posting. One key strategy to get past ATS and into the hands of the recruiter is the use of keywords.

Keywords refer to the particular words or phrases that recruiters look for in a resume or job application. In the case of a Drupal Developer, keywords can be the specific skills you possess (like Drupal, PHP, HTML/CSS, or soft skills like teamwork and problem-solving).

Incorporating these keywords in your skills section increases the chances of getting a positive score from the ATS. What's more, it shows the recruiter that you possess the essential skills for the job. However, stuffing your resume with keywords without proof of those skills in your experience will likely not impress a human recruiter.


Hard and soft skills aid recruiters to gauge your technical expertise and your teamwork and communication capabilities. The ATS uses keywords to screen resumes. Hence, incorporating these skills as keywords will likely improve your resume's ATS score. However, you must ensure these skills are applicable to the job on hand and substantiate them with details in your work history or projects to appeal to both the ATS and the recruiter indeed.

Top Hard & Soft Skills for Full Stack Developers

Hard Skills

  • PHP
  • Drupal
  • HTML
  • CSS
  • JavaScript
  • MySQL
  • Git
  • Twig
  • RESTful APIs
  • jQuery
  • SASS
  • Bootstrap
  • Web Development
  • Module Development
  • Theme Development
  • Soft Skills

  • Problem-solving
  • Attention to detail
  • Teamwork
  • Communication
  • Time management
  • Adaptability
  • Creativity
  • Critical thinking
  • Collaboration
  • Organization
  • Self-motivation
  • Client interaction
  • Leadership
  • Empathy
  • Continuous learning
  • Top Action Verbs

    Use action verbs to highlight achievements and responsibilities on your resume.

  • Developed
  • Implemented
  • Designed
  • Customized
  • Debugged
  • Optimized
  • Collaborated
  • Communicated
  • Resolved
  • Tested
  • Deployed
  • Maintained
  • Integrated
  • Configured
  • Updated
  • Supported
  • Documented
  • Trained
  • Reviewed
  • Solved
  • Presented
  • Managed
  • Evaluated
  • Consulted
  • Advised
  • Mentored
  • Contributed
  • Enhanced
  • Deployed
  • Secured
  • Automated
  • Validated
  • Monitored
  • Implemented
  • Optimized
  • Evaluated
  • Documented
  • Education

    The best way to include your education and certificates on your resume as a Drupal Developer is to create a separate section titled "Education/Certifications." Here, list your educational qualifications with the name of the institutions, graduation dates, and any honors achieved. For certifications, include the certification name, issuing authority, and date of attainment. Ensure to list the most recent or relevant qualifications first. Your Drupal certification, if attained, should be a highlight here as it directly pertains to your profession.

    Resume FAQs for Drupal Developers


    What is the ideal format for a Drupal developer resume?


    The ideal format for a Drupal developer resume is a clean, well-structured layout that highlights your technical skills, projects, and achievements. Use a reverse-chronological format, with your most recent experience listed first. Include sections for your technical skills, Drupal expertise, projects, and any relevant certifications or awards.


    What is the recommended length for a Drupal developer resume?


    The recommended length for a Drupal developer resume is typically one page for candidates with less than 10 years of experience, and up to two pages for those with more extensive experience. Focus on including the most relevant and impactful information, and avoid unnecessary details or fluff.


    How can I effectively showcase my Drupal skills on my resume?


    To effectively showcase your Drupal skills, create a dedicated section for your Drupal expertise. List the specific versions of Drupal you have worked with, any contributed modules or custom modules you have developed, and any Drupal-related certifications or training you have completed. Highlight any notable Drupal projects you have worked on, including their scope, your role, and the technologies or techniques used.


    What are some key technical skills to include on a Drupal developer resume?


    Some key technical skills to include on a Drupal developer resume are: PHP, MySQL, HTML, CSS, JavaScript, Drupal module development, Drupal theming, Drush, Git, Composer, Agile methodologies, responsive design, and any relevant frameworks or libraries you have experience with (e.g., React, Angular, Vue.js, Bootstrap).


    How can I make my Drupal developer resume stand out?


    To make your Drupal developer resume stand out, highlight any unique or complex projects you have worked on, showcasing your problem-solving skills and ability to tackle challenging tasks. Quantify your achievements with metrics or statistics whenever possible (e.g., improved site performance by 30%, reduced development time by 20%). Additionally, consider including links to your GitHub profile, personal website, or any open-source contributions you have made to demonstrate your passion for the Drupal community.

    Drupal Developer Resume Example

    As a Drupal Developer, you architect robust websites on the powerful Drupal CMS. Leveraging PHP, MySQL and custom modules, you ensure optimal performance and user experiences. On your resume, highlight proficiencies across Drupal versions, modules and frameworks. Showcase coding projects with descriptions of custom functionality built. Include quantifiable achievements like boosted traffic or conversions. Relevant certifications can strengthen your credibility.

    Rick Bryant
    (224) 516-0469
    Drupal Developer

    Highly skilled Drupal Developer with over 7 years of experience in designing, developing, and maintaining complex Drupal websites. Proven track record of delivering high-quality, scalable solutions that exceed client expectations. Passionate about staying up-to-date with the latest web technologies and contributing to the Drupal community.

    Work Experience
    Senior Drupal Developer
    06/2019 - Present
    • Led the development of large-scale Drupal projects for enterprise clients, resulting in a 30% increase in client satisfaction.
    • Implemented custom modules and themes to enhance website functionality and user experience.
    • Optimized website performance through code refactoring and database tuning, reducing page load times by 40%.
    • Collaborated with cross-functional teams to ensure seamless integration of Drupal with third-party systems.
    • Mentored junior developers and provided technical guidance to the team.
    Drupal Developer
    03/2016 - 05/2019
    • Developed and maintained Drupal websites for a diverse range of clients, including non-profits and educational institutions.
    • Implemented responsive design and accessibility best practices to ensure websites were inclusive and user-friendly.
    • Integrated Drupal with various CRM and marketing automation platforms, such as Salesforce and Marketo.
    • Conducted code reviews and provided constructive feedback to improve code quality and maintainability.
    • Contributed to the Drupal community by submitting patches and participating in local meetups.
    Junior Drupal Developer
    08/2014 - 02/2016
    • Assisted senior developers in the development and maintenance of Drupal websites.
    • Developed custom Drupal modules to extend core functionality and meet client requirements.
    • Collaborated with designers to implement responsive and mobile-friendly themes.
    • Participated in code sprints and contributed to open-source Drupal modules.
    • Conducted thorough testing and debugging to ensure high-quality deliverables.
  • Drupal 7/8/9
  • PHP
  • MySQL
  • HTML5
  • CSS3
  • JavaScript
  • jQuery
  • Git
  • Composer
  • Drush
  • Responsive Web Design
  • Web Accessibility
  • Agile Development
  • RESTful APIs
  • Symfony
  • Twig
  • SASS
  • Gulp
  • Webpack
  • Education
    Bachelor of Science in Computer Science
    09/2010 - 05/2014
    University of California, Los Angeles (UCLA), Los Angeles, CA